    In this episode of the Let’s Be Clear Podcast, Pastor Jamal Bryant sits down with Pastor Justin, a tech pastor from Silicon Valley, for a real conversation about artificial intelligence and what it means for the church and the Black community. Pastor Justin breaks down how AI is already shaping everyday life and why many people do not realize how their data is being used. What feels free online may actually be costing more than people think. He explains how the digital divide is growing and how it impacts access, opportunity, and long term wealth. He also shares why the church must adapt now to stay connected to the next generation. The conversation also covers how AI may replace millions of jobs while creating new ones, and what skills will matter most in the future.
